    Abstract: Systems and methods for cleaning a storage system. A deduplicated storage system is cleaned by identifying structures that include dead or unreferenced segments. This includes processing recipes to identify the segments that are no longer part of a live object recipe. Then, the dead segments are removed. This is accomplished by copying forward the live segments and then deleting, as a whole, the structure that included the dead segments.

    Abstract: A method includes receiving, by a processor, bias data categories. A data input from a user for classification in data categories is received. A classification machine learning model is utilized to classify the data input in at least one data category and determine a first confidence probability in a classification outcome. A bias filter machine learning model is utilized to determine a second confidence probability that the classification outcome of classifying the data input into the at least one data category is based on at least one bias characteristic associated with at least one bias data category. A gate machine learning model is utilized to determine when to output the classification outcome of classifying the data input into the at least one data category to a computing device of a user based at least in part on the first confidence probability, the second confidence probability, and a predefined bias threshold.

    Abstract: Examples for enabling off-network transactions to be performed and securely managed are provided. An example system may include a data network, a digital ledger server, a blockchain platform, smart payment devices, and point of sale devices. Each respective point of sale device and each respective smart device may be operable to perform an off-network transaction, and store information related to the transaction in a digital ledger coupled to each respective device. When a transaction is executed between a POS device and a smart payment device, the POS device and smart payment device exchange a record of all off-network transactions that each respective device has executed since the last time a connection was made to the data network. When a network connection is established for each device, the respective information stored in the digital ledger is uploaded to the blockchain platform for storage and the digital ledger server for transaction resolution.

    Abstract: Techniques for protecting passwords and/or password entry by a user are provided. User identification data for a user can be received from a remote computing device. An identity of the user can be determined based on the user identification data. A password for the user can be determined. A modified keyboard configuration associated with the user can be determined. A request can be transmitted to the remote computing device for the password for the user based on the modified keyboard configuration. A modified password from the remote computing device can be received. A converted password based on the modified password and the modified keyboard configuration can be determined. The converted password can be compared to the password for the user. The user can be authorized when the converted password matches the password for the user.
